package org.apache.qetest.trax;
// Support for test reporting and harness classes
import org.apache.qetest.*;
import org.apache.qetest.xsl.*;
// Import all relevant TRAX packages
import javax.xml.transform.*;
import javax.xml.transform.dom.*;
import javax.xml.transform.sax.*;
import javax.xml.transform.stream.*;
import javax.xml.parsers.DocumentBuilder;
import javax.xml.parsers.DocumentBuilderFactory;
import javax.xml.parsers.SAXParserFactory;
// Needed SAX, DOM, JAXP classes
import org.xml.sax.InputSource;
import org.xml.sax.XMLReader;
import org.w3c.dom.Node;
// java classes
import java.io.File;
import java.io.FilenameFilter;
import java.util.Properties;
//-------------------------------------------------------------------------
/**
* Verify that ErrorListeners are called properly from Transformers.
* @author shane_curcuru@lotus.com
* @version $Id: ErrorListenerTest.java,v 1.1 2001/02/22 15:14:36 curcuru Exp $
*/
public class ErrorListenerTest extends XSLProcessorTestBase
{
/** Provide sequential output names automatically. */
protected OutputNameManager outNames;
/** FilenameFilter that lists appropriate tests in api/err directory to use. */
protected FilenameFilter errorFileFilter = null;
/**
* A simple stylesheet with errors for testing in various flavors.
* Must be coordinated with templatesExpectedType/Value,
* transformExpectedType/Value.
*/
protected XSLTestfileInfo testFileInfo = new XSLTestfileInfo();
/** Expected type of error during stylesheet build. */
protected int templatesExpectedType = 0;
/** Expected String of error during stylesheet build. */
protected String templatesExpectedValue = null;
/** Expected type of error during transform. */
protected int transformExpectedType = 0;
/** Expected String of error during transform. */
protected String transformExpectedValue = null;
/** Subdirectory under test\tests\api for our xsl/xml files. */
public static final String ERR_SUBDIR = "err";
/** Name of expected parent test\tests\api directory. */
public static final String API_PARENTDIR = "api";
/** Just initialize test name, comment, numTestCases. */
public ErrorListenerTest()
{
numTestCases = 3; // REPLACE_num
testName = "ErrorListenerTest";
testComment = "Verify that ErrorListeners are called properly from Transformers.";
}
/**
* Initialize this test
*
* @param p Properties to initialize from (if needed)
* @return false if we should abort the test; true otherwise
*/
public boolean doTestFileInit(Properties p)
{
// Used for all tests; just dump files in trax subdir
File outSubDir = new File(outputDir + File.separator + ERR_SUBDIR);
if (!outSubDir.mkdirs())
reporter.logWarningMsg("Could not create output dir: " + outSubDir);
// Initialize an output name manager to that dir with .out extension
outNames = new OutputNameManager(outputDir + File.separator + ERR_SUBDIR
+ File.separator + testName, ".out");
errorFileFilter = new ConformanceErrFileRules(API_PARENTDIR);
String testBasePath = inputDir
+ File.separator
+ ERR_SUBDIR
+ File.separator;
String goldBasePath = goldDir
+ File.separator
+ ERR_SUBDIR
+ File.separator;
testFileInfo.inputName = testBasePath + "ErrorListenerTest.xsl";
testFileInfo.xmlName = testBasePath + "ErrorListenerTest.xml";
testFileInfo.goldName = goldBasePath + "ErrorListenerTest.out";
templatesExpectedType = LoggingErrorListener.TYPE_FATALERROR;
templatesExpectedValue = "decimal-format names must be unique. Name \"myminus\" has been duplicated";
transformExpectedType = LoggingErrorListener.TYPE_WARNING;
transformExpectedValue = "ExpectedMessage from:list1";
return true;
}
/**
* Build a stylesheet/do a transform with a known-bad stylesheet.
* Verify that the ErrorListener is called properly.
* Primarily using StreamSources.
* @return false if we should abort the test; true otherwise
*/
public boolean testCase1()
{
reporter.testCaseInit("Build a stylesheet/do a transform with a known-bad stylesheet");
LoggingErrorListener loggingErrorListener = new LoggingErrorListener(reporter);
loggingErrorListener.setThrowWhen(LoggingErrorListener.THROW_NEVER);
reporter.logTraceMsg("loggingErrorListener originally setup:" + loggingErrorListener.getQuickCounters());
TransformerFactory factory = null;
Templates templates = null;
Transformer transformer = null;
try
{
factory = TransformerFactory.newInstance();
// Set the errorListener and validate it
factory.setErrorListener(loggingErrorListener);
reporter.check((factory.getErrorListener() == loggingErrorListener),
true, "set/getErrorListener on factory");
// Attempt to build templates from known-bad stylesheet
// Validate known errors in stylesheet building
loggingErrorListener.setExpected(templatesExpectedType,
templatesExpectedValue);
reporter.logInfoMsg("About to factory.newTemplates(" + filenameToURL(testFileInfo.inputName) + ")");
templates = factory.newTemplates(new StreamSource(filenameToURL(testFileInfo.inputName)));
reporter.logTraceMsg("loggingErrorListener after newTemplates:" + loggingErrorListener.getQuickCounters());
// Clear out any setExpected or counters
loggingErrorListener.reset();
reporter.checkPass("set ErrorListener prevented any exceptions in newTemplates()");
// This stylesheet will still work, even though errors
// were detected during it's building. Note that
// future versions of Xalan or other processors may
// not be able to continue here...
transformer = templates.newTransformer();
reporter.logTraceMsg("default transformer's getErrorListener is: " + transformer.getErrorListener());
// Set the errorListener and validate it
transformer.setErrorListener(loggingErrorListener);
reporter.check((transformer.getErrorListener() == loggingErrorListener),
true, "set/getErrorListener on transformer");
// Validate the first xsl:message call in the stylesheet
loggingErrorListener.setExpected(transformExpectedType,
transformExpectedValue);
reporter.logTraceMsg("about to transform(...)");
transformer.transform(new StreamSource(filenameToURL(testFileInfo.xmlName)),
new StreamResult(outNames.nextName()));
reporter.logTraceMsg("after transform(...)");
// Clear out any setExpected or counters
loggingErrorListener.reset();
// Validate the actual output file as well: in this case,
// the stylesheet should still work
if (Logger.PASS_RESULT
!= fileChecker.check(reporter,
new File(outNames.currentName()),
new File(testFileInfo.goldName),
"transform of error xsl into: " + outNames.currentName())
)
reporter.logInfoMsg("transform of error xsl failure reason:" + fileChecker.getExtendedInfo());
}
catch (Throwable t)
{
reporter.checkFail("errorListener unexpectedly threw: " + t.toString());
reporter.logThrowable(Logger.ERRORMSG, t, "errorListener unexpectedly threw");
}
reporter.testCaseClose();
return true;
}
